Out and about this evening over a place called Wallasea Island it is a huge man made RSPB site with so many different birds too many to list it looks across the river crouch to Burnham On Crouch  and also to Foulness Island the MOD testing site I might be wrong but I believe it’s one of the few places you can test missiles up to 60,000 feet, most of the little islands that are here were made with the spoil from the channel tunnel which was shipped up the River Thames on barges.

Land Cruiser , belting motor how long have you had it is it lc3 or lc4 ? Seriously considering investing in one as it would be practical in a number of ways for us 

Hello Bob, it’s an LC5 3.0 D4D top spec I’ve owned it 7 years it’s a 2005 I deliberately went for that year because it is the lower tax bracket £350 per annum I believe later than that it goes to £700+, it’s extremely reliable all I’ve had to change is a suspension sensor on one side I changed both to be on the safe side they were original about 18 years old and this year on the mot I had a wheel bearing changed just wear and tear which you would expect, I’ve got Maxxis Wormdrive tyres all round and they are great on and off road, what I like about it is it’s an 8 seater the back three seats just come out really easy and it then becomes like a van I’ve had x2 ton bags of wood in there half a ton of concrete nothing fazes it, it’s also my family car and drives lovely on long trips and it is my farm wagon in the season very versatile.

if I bought another one I’d go for the LC4 as it’s spring suspension rather than air bags I’ve had no problems but just easier to change if there are issues but the motor was in such good nick I went with it, good luck finding a good one have a good look underneath before you buy and check the arches and seat areas for rust, if you find a good one you won’t go wrong I was looking for over six months to find the one I’ve got.
